A bipartisan group of House lawmakers led by Colorado Republican Ken Buck will introduce legislation this week that would form a new task force aimed at combating the nationwide surge in mob retail theft. Buck told Fox News his bill, which he will introduce Friday, is a companion to Iowa Sen. Charles Grassley's Combating Organized Retail Crime Act, and characterized it as a strong, bipartisan response to the nationwide crime wave.
Buck blamed President Biden and the administration for failing to get a handle on the chaos. "The explosion of organized, smash-and-grab looting of retail stores is a symptom of the underlying collapse of law and order in America under the Biden administration," Buck told Fox News, disputing Biden's 2021 claim that crime is "down." A group of about 100 juveniles looted a Wawa in Philadelphia's Mayfair section, Sept. 24, 2022.
(Philadelphia Police) Buck said the bipartisan and bicameral legislation will help police and federal law enforcement stop future "attacks" on businesses by improving bureaucratic coordination and ensuring proper punishment for culprits. The task force bill will cite figures stating that for every $1 billion in 2019 U.S. retail sales, $720,000 of that consists of embezzled or purloined goods.

A group of thieves completed a smash-and-grab raid on a Park Avenue jewelry store early Saturday morning, taking merchandise worth hundreds of thousands of dollars, police said. New York City Police (NYPD) said that three thieves broke through the glass front of Cellini Jewelers near E. 56th St. at around 3:30 a.m.The group broke three display cases containing hundreds of thousands of dollars-worth of watches and other jewelry. The thieves escaped in a silver sedan that waited outside the store, completing the entire heist in under three minutes, according to police.

A California man was kidnapped in broad daylight and remains missing as of Sunday afternoon, according to local reports and police. The Los Angles County Sheriff’s Department (LASD) said two male suspects exited a 2008 silver Infiniti G-35 on Michillinda Avenue near Colorado Boulevard in the Pasadena area Thursday. Stills of the suspected kidnapping suspects. (LASD) The suspects were seen attacking a man on a sidewalk and dragging him into the back seat of the Infiniti, FOX 11 reported, citing LASD. The suspects were last seen driving south on Michillinda Avenue with California license plate number 6FMY326. Anyone with information is asked to call 562-946-7150. Fox News has reached out to the sheriff’s department for updates in this case.
